Summary
"Wayne Schooley, a young soldier returning from France after the end of the great war is stricken with the dreaded Spanish flu (1918 influenza pandemic.) Fighting his way back from death's door, he returns home to find his parents are dead, victims of the dreaded disease. Putting his life back together, he is helped by an old friend, the sheriff of the town. He reunites with the sheriff's daughter Cassie, who is now a nurse. Wayne and his friend, Lyle, take jobs as deputies in the growing town of Marshfield, Wisconsin. But, with prohibition to soon be the new law of the land, the two young men are caught up in the violence that ensues. Yet, along the way, Wayne and Cassie find love. Follow their adventures as the year 1919 changes their lives forever."--Back cover
